Step 4: Before promoting the Ledgerline conversion service, confirm the rounding fix is active. All currency conversions must round half-to-even at four decimal places; earlier builds truncated, which caused penny-level drift in refunds. Support should spot-check three refund tickets after deploy. The release artifact must be signed, so attach the signing key shown below.

rollout seal: bky4_x7Gc

## Ownership

The Brightledger PDF invoice renderer is maintained by the Billing Platform group at Vantrell Systems. Layout templates live in `templates/`; touching them requires a rendering snapshot diff in your review. Do not approve changes to currency formatting without a second reviewer. All merges to this module require sign-off from the maintainer named below.

named custodian: Quenael Briax

This release changes several dispatch defaults in LiftSim, the elevator-dispatch simulator maintained by the Varnholt platform team. The default dispatch algorithm is now destination-group rather than nearest-car, and idle cars park at lobby level instead of last-served floor. Simulated door-dwell time increased from 3s to 5s to match field data from the Brenmark tower study. Release managers should verify downstream scenario packs against these values before promoting. The full set of shipped defaults is listed below.

service settings:
[silwyn]
host = silwyn.crelvogrid.internal
user = silwyn_svc
database = silwyn_prod

## Partner SFTP Drop — Marlowe Freight

Files land nightly between 02:00–03:30 UTC in the inbound drop. Watcher job `marlowe-ingest` picks them up; if nothing arrives by 04:00, the Quillhook alert fires. Do NOT re-request files from Marlowe before checking the quarantine folder — malformed headers get parked there silently. Retries are safe; ingest is idempotent on file checksum. Rotation of the drop credentials is quarterly, owned by platform. Full escalation steps and contacts are on the runbook page.

dashboard of taduf-tahof = https://confluence.tolvaqlabs.internal/browse/browse/display/f01240ca